6. Myocardial ischemia and reperfusion injury, clinical and experimental studies
Abstract : Acute myocardial infarction is the consequence of an occluded nutrient coronary artery. Reperfusion reduces infarct size and enhances the rate of survival. But reperfusion may also, in itself, cause reversible injury, stunning and arrhythmias, as well as irreversible lethal reperfusion injury. READ MORE

7. Pulmonary Injury Following Intestinal Ischemia and Reperfusion in Rats
Abstract : Intestinal ischemia and reperfusion (I/R) is a potentially life-threatening condition, sometimes leading to a systemic inflammatory response and the potential development of the multiple organ dysfunction syndrome. The overall aim of the thesis was to study the effects of intestinal I/R on pulmonary function with special emphasis on removal of excess alveolar fluid, pulmonary endothelial barrier permeability, leukocyte accumulation and function, and possible therapeutic strategies to prevent the development of pulmonary injury following intestinal I/R. 8. ST-elevation myocardial infarction : studies of outcome in relation to fibrinolysis and ischemia monitoring with on-line vectorcardiography
Abstract : The treatment of acute myocardial infarction (AMI) has undergone a tremendous development during the last decades, and the most important factor is probably the introduction of reperfusion therapy aimed at preventing or limiting the myocardial injury. It is of vital importance that patients with AMI are adequately monitored regarding the development of ECG changes during and after treatment to identify successful or failed reperfusion and to detect episodes of recurrent ischemia. 10. Liver transplantation in man. Gastrointestinal perfusion and inflammatory response
Abstract : Patients undergoing liver transplantation develop a systemic inflammatory response which eventually continues with development of a multiple organ dysfunction syndrome (MODS). Gastro-intestinal hypoxia or bacterial translocation has been proposed as the "motor" of MODS. READ MORE
